We have different rules when its really hot and light in the evenings - DS2 (5)(as did his two older sibs) can play or potter about upstairs/ 'read' on his bed while I sort out the laundry and other sundry upstairs jobs, until it gets a bit cooler and darker.

I have always found its just not worth the fuss and bother of us all getting steaming hot and bothered about it in this weather.

He went off to bed about 7.30 as usual but it sounded as if he then spent a happy 20 minutes singing 'wind the bobbin up' with his teddies!
